At Broward Health North in Deerfield Beach, hands-on training just got a high-tech boost.
Thanks to a $500,000 gift from the Broward Health Foundation, the health system has transformed its Simulation and Learning Center into a cutting-edge hub for clinical education—now officially renamed in honor of the foundation’s support. The investment brings in state-of-the-art patient simulators—three adult, one pediatric, and one neonatal—designed to replicate real-world medical scenarios with striking realism. These advanced tools allow healthcare professionals to hone their skills in a controlled, risk-free environment.
For nurses, physicians, and clinical staff across Broward Health’s expansive network—including four hospitals, outpatient clinics, and physician groups—this upgrade means sharper skills, faster response times, and better outcomes for patients across South Florida.
“I am incredibly proud to see our campus serve as the home of such an advanced, transformational learning environment,” said Eileen Manniste, Chief Nursing Officer at Broward Health North. “This investment elevates the training available to our frontline teams and improves care across the board.”
The upgraded center supports a wide range of programs—from nursing orientation for recent grads to advanced simulation for emergency and critical care staff. It also includes specialty training for neonatal and pediatric care, as well as progressive care coursework in collaboration with Broward College, all aligned with safety and regulatory goals.
